| Software notes | This welder does not rely on any external control software or require cloud connectivity. The interface is based on direct manual controls via potentiometers, complemented by two digital displays that show preset voltage and wire feed speed during setup, as well as actual values during welding. The lack of complex IT management makes it a purely analog product that is straightforward to operate in the field. | The machine is equipped with an intuitive proprietary digital interface featuring a large color display. The "Ready.Set.Weld" system guides the operator through the setup process by suggesting optimal parameters (voltage and wire feed speed) based on inputs such as material type, thickness, and wire diameter. It does not require any external software or cloud connectivity. |
The differences that matter
- Price: POWER MIG 256 3250 € vs POWER MIG 210 MP Aluminum One-Pak 2250 € — POWER MIG 210 MP Aluminum One-Pak wins (+44%)
- Synergic control: POWER MIG 210 MP Aluminum One-Pak yes, POWER MIG 256 no
- Max wire feed speed: POWER MIG 256 17.78 m/min vs POWER MIG 210 MP Aluminum One-Pak 12.7 m/min — POWER MIG 256 wins (+40%)
